Transaction 7d21e2af5569efbdb81a91b215862f792c4e8317d7ec6b89893d58ae14be8b14
2 Input
2 Outputs
- 7d21e2af5569efbdb81a91b215862f792c4e8317d7ec6b89893d58ae14be8b14:0
- 7d21e2af5569efbdb81a91b215862f792c4e8317d7ec6b89893d58ae14be8b14:1
value 417000
address 3DYDikZq92jaMz9kPVdQqnE1bTkhf1Fbbk
value 575820
address 16ySjySdnwu8F8pTdeYfLpwqXSfjdDjcCG